8. A railway safety system, comprising:
a first electrical communication device configured to be in communication with a control center;
a second electrical communication device configured to be carried by a rail worker; and
a vehicle unit configured to be coupled to a rail vehicle, the vehicle unit including:
a location determination unit configured to determine a location of the rail vehicle,
a transceiver configured to:
transmit the location of the rail vehicle to the first electrical communication device;
receive an alarm signal indicating that a first distance between the rail vehicle and a geographical boundary is less than a first threshold distance;
an alarm unit configured to generate at least one of an audio or visual alarm in response to the alarm signal;
wherein:
the geographical boundary is defined independent of a speed of the rail vehicle; and
the second electrical communication device is configured to receive an alert indicating that a second distance between the rail worker and the geographical boundary is less than a second threshold distance.
